Project overview

There has been a demonstrated need for a variable voltage, variable frequency, single phase power supply in the Engineering Laboratory at Newcastle. The aim of this project is to design and simulate such a single phase power supply. The power supply should have the same features as typical DC power supplies. That is there should be a facility to adjust the output voltage magnitude, and limit the output current magnitude. In addition the user should be able to adjust the output frequency independently of and in proportion to the output voltage based on a user selection.
